ABOUT US
ClaimSorted helps insurers outsource claims end to end – a service called Third-Party Administration (TPA), a ~$200B industry. We combine a strong in-house claims team with our AI-enabled platform to deliver up to 3× faster claims, better service, and better economics for insurers.
Backed by Y Combinator, Atomico, and Eurazeo, we’ve raised $15M+ and already manage claims for over $100M in insurance premium across 30+ MGAs, including more than five publicly traded companies. Our goal: scale to $1B and become the most valuable TPA in the market.
